Balcony Waterproofing Questions
What is balcony waterproofing? Balcony waterproofing involves applying a protective layer to prevent water from penetrating the surface and causing damage.
Why is waterproofing important for balconies? Proper waterproofing helps avoid water leaks, structural damage, and mold growth on balconies.
What types of waterproofing materials are used? Common materials include liquid membranes, membrane sheets, and sealants designed for outdoor use.
How often should balcony waterproofing be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ended to identify and address any signs of wear or damage early.
